Rückkehrmigration am Beispiel Italiens: Steueranreize zeigen Wirkung

Abstract

"Seit vielen Jahren versucht Deutschland aufgrund des zunehmenden Fachkräftemangels hochqualifizierte Zuwandernde anzuziehen. Deutschland konkurriert hierbei nicht nur mit anderen Zielländern mit vergleichbarem Fachkräftemangel, sondern auch mit den Auswanderungsländern selbst. Einige Staaten, die vom Wegzug einheimischer Fachkräfte betroffen sind, versuchen diese zur Rückkehr ins Heimatland zu bewegen. Sie locken unter anderem mit hohen Steuerermäßigungen für Rückkehrende, wie sie beispielsweise Italien im Jahr 2010 eingeführt hat – mit nicht unerheblichem Erfolg." (Autorenreferat, IAB-Doku)
